The Top 5 Scorers for the 10 Greatest National Teams in Football History – Ranked
Scoring goals on the international stage is one of the greatest honors in football. While clubs define careers, national teams define legacies. From dazzling World Cup moments to unforgettable European Championships and Copa América triumphs, these elite goal scorers have carried the hopes of their nations on the biggest stages.
This article highlights the five all-time leading goal scorers for each of the 10 most iconic national teams in football history — legends who defined eras and brought glory to their countries. From Messi and Ronaldo to Klose and Henry, here are the names every football fan should know.
Netherlands

The Dutch have produced a long list of world-class forwards, blending flair, precision, and creativity. Their top scorers reflect the nation’s attacking legacy on the global stage.
Robin van Persie – 50 goals

Van Persie leads the Netherlands with 50 goals, known for his elegant finishing and sharp football IQ. His flying header against Spain remains a timeless World Cup moment.
Read also: The 25 Best Stadiums in World Football - Ranked
Memphis Depay – 46 goals

A modern star, Depay combines skill, strength, and unpredictability. He has been a consistent goal threat throughout the 2010s and early 2020s.
Klaas-Jan Huntelaar – 42 goals

A traditional striker with a lethal touch inside the box, Huntelaar delivered goals with efficiency. He was a dependable scorer during major tournament runs.
Patrick Kluivert – 40 goals

Kluivert brought a mix of finesse and power to the Dutch front line. His impact was especially felt during Euro 2000.
Arjen Robben – 37 goals

Robben’s speed and left-footed strikes were feared worldwide. He played a key role in leading the Netherlands to the 2010 World Cup final.
Read also: The 15 Best Centre-Backs in the Premier League - Ranked from Lowest to Highest
Italy

Italy’s goal scorers are known for their blend of technique and tactical awareness. From historic legends to modern icons, they’ve made their mark on the Azzurri.
Luigi Riva – 35 goals

Italy’s all-time top scorer, Riva was known for his thunderous strikes. He helped lead Italy to their Euro 1968 victory.
Giuseppe Meazza – 33 goals

A pre-war legend, Meazza was Italy’s star in their early World Cup triumphs. His balance and vision set the standard for generations.
Silvio Piola – 30 goals

Piola played a vital role in Italy’s 1938 World Cup win. He was known for his versatility and clinical finishing.
Read also: The 20 Most Followed Footballers on Instagram in 2025 - Ranked
Roberto Baggio – 27 goals

One of the most beloved players in Italian history, Baggio dazzled with skill and grace. His 1994 World Cup run remains iconic despite the penalty heartbreak.
Alessandro Del Piero – 27 goals

Del Piero was elegance personified, known for his curling free kicks and calm presence. A symbol of Italy’s golden era.
Germany

Germany has a long tradition of prolific and efficient goal scorers. Their legends have left an indelible mark on World Cup history.
Miroslav Klose – 71 goals

Klose holds the all-time World Cup scoring record. Known for his humility and positioning, he’s a German legend.
Read also: The 25 Greatest Finishers in Football History – Ranked
Gerd Müller – 68 goals

"The Bomber" was a scoring machine in the 1970s. His goals fired Germany to both European and World Cup titles.
Lukas Podolski – 49 goals

With a thunderous left foot and unmatched passion, Podolski was a fan favorite. He brought energy and goals for over a decade.
Rudi Völler – 47 goals

A composed striker and later a manager, Völler was instrumental in Germany’s 1990 World Cup win. He was a consistent performer at major tournaments.
Jürgen Klinsmann – 47 goals

Fast, instinctive, and smart in the box, Klinsmann scored in three World Cups. He later led the national team from the sidelines as coach.
Read also: The 10 Strongest Football Players in the World - Ranked
Belgium

Belgium’s golden generation has elevated its footballing status. Their top scorers reflect both modern talent and historical contributions.
Romelu Lukaku – 85 goals

Lukaku leads Belgium with power, pace, and precision. He’s been central to Belgium’s recent international success.
Eden Hazard – 33 goals

Known for his dribbling and flair, Hazard was also a reliable scorer. His leadership helped Belgium reach new heights.
Bernard Voorhoof – 30 goals

A pioneer of Belgian football, Voorhoof was one of the earliest scoring stars. His name still stands among the country’s greats.
Paul Van Himst – 30 goals

An elegant forward, Van Himst was a creative and clinical striker. He starred during the 1960s and 70s.
Marc Wilmots – 29 goals

Wilmots combined passion and power, often stepping up in big games. He later served as national team manager.
Spain

Spain’s top scorers have blended individual brilliance with tactical discipline. Their golden era from 2008–2012 transformed their footballing identity.
David Villa – 59 goals

Villa’s movement and finishing made him Spain’s all-time top scorer. He was crucial in their Euro 2008 and 2010 World Cup triumphs.
Raúl González – 44 goals

Raúl was a symbol of consistency and elegance. Though he missed the golden era, he laid the foundation.
Fernando Torres – 38 goals

“El Niño” had a knack for big goals, including finals. His pace and finishing were vital in Spain’s golden run.
Álvaro Morata – 37 goals

Morata has become a dependable scorer in recent years. He’s often stepped up when Spain needed goals the most.
David Silva – 35 goals

Silva combined intelligence with technical brilliance. A creative force who also chipped in with key goals.
England

England’s goalscoring greats reflect different eras of the game. From classic No. 9s to modern superstars, they’ve all delivered on the big stage.
Harry Kane – 69 goals

Kane blends clinical finishing with leadership. As captain, he became England’s all-time top scorer with key goals in major tournaments.
Wayne Rooney – 53 goals

A teenage prodigy turned record-holder, Rooney brought fire and finesse. He was England’s go-to man for over a decade.
Bobby Charlton – 49 goals

Charlton was a World Cup winner and a midfield scorer with a thunderous shot. His legacy lives on through England’s 1966 success.
Gary Lineker – 48 goals

A natural poacher and World Cup Golden Boot winner, Lineker was famously never booked. He epitomized efficiency up front.
Jimmy Greaves – 44 goals

Greaves was a genius in front of goal with dazzling footwork. Despite World Cup heartbreak in 1966, his scoring record is elite.
France

France’s scorers range from vintage playmakers to modern-day stars. Their diverse attacking talents reflect the evolution of Les Bleus.
Olivier Giroud – 57 goals

Giroud quietly became France’s all-time top scorer. His strength, technique, and team-first mentality made him indispensable.
Thierry Henry – 51 goals

Henry brought speed, elegance, and composure. A World Cup and Euro winner, he remains an all-time great.
Kylian Mbappé – 48 goals

Mbappé is rewriting records with blistering pace and lethal finishing. Already a World Cup winner, the sky’s the limit.
Antoine Griezmann – 44 goals

Griezmann combines work rate with flair. A consistent scorer and creator, he’s vital to France’s modern success.
Michel Platini – 41 goals

Platini was a midfield maestro with a golden boot at Euro 1984. His vision and free-kicks set him apart.
Argentina

From magical No. 10s to clinical finishers, Argentina’s scorers are icons of world football. Their passion and flair captivate fans globally.
Lionel Messi – 112 goals

The GOAT for many, Messi leads Argentina in goals and glory. He crowned his legacy with a World Cup win in 2022.
Gabriel Batistuta – 55 goals

Batistuta was a powerhouse with incredible accuracy. He dominated for Argentina in the 1990s with unforgettable strikes.
Sergio Agüero – 41 goals

Agüero brought pace and deadly finishing to the Albiceleste. Injuries limited him at times, but his talent never faded.
Hernán Crespo – 35 goals

Crespo was clinical and calm under pressure. His contributions spanned multiple major tournaments.
Diego Maradona – 32 goals

A genius with the ball, Maradona inspired Argentina’s 1986 World Cup triumph. His goals and leadership are part of football folklore.
Brazil

Brazilian scorers combine flair, rhythm, and joy. Their magic on the ball has enchanted generations.
Neymar – 79 goals

Neymar became Brazil’s top scorer with dazzling dribbles and clutch goals. He’s carried the Seleção through a transitional era.
Pelé – 77 goals

A three-time World Cup winner, Pelé remains a global icon. His goals, charisma, and vision transcended the sport.
Ronaldo Nazário – 62 goals

Ronaldo was unstoppable in his prime, with speed and finishing that left defenders helpless. He led Brazil to the 2002 World Cup.
Romário – 55 goals

Romário’s instinct inside the box was unmatched. He was the face of Brazil’s 1994 World Cup win.
Zico – 48 goals

Zico was a creative force with a powerful shot and set-piece mastery. One of the greatest not to win a World Cup.
Portugal

Portugal’s top scorers have brought the nation to football’s elite. Their rise to the top has been led by one of the game’s true greats.
Cristiano Ronaldo – 135 goals

The highest international scorer in football history, Ronaldo redefined consistency and professionalism. He carried Portugal to Euro and Nations League titles.
Pauleta – 47 goals

Before Ronaldo’s rise, Pauleta was Portugal’s go-to striker. He had a strong presence during the early 2000s.
Eusébio – 41 goals

The “Black Panther” was a World Cup icon in 1966. His speed, power, and spirit made him a Portuguese legend.
Luís Figo – 32 goals

Figo dazzled with creativity and control. A Ballon d’Or winner, he combined playmaking with goal contributions at the highest level.
Nuno Gomes – 29 goals

Nuno Gomes was a consistent threat in the box. His contributions were vital during Portugal’s early 2000s rise.